JOB DESCRIPTION

Job Title:  STUDY TOURS ESL ACADEMIC MANAGER (Sydney - based)

Full Time & Permanent
 

ABOUT BLUE SKY EDUCATION

As a global Study Tour services provider with a presence in the UK,  Australia and Singapore, BlueSky Education provides short-term and skills-based programmes for students in Australia, Singapore/Malaysia, Japan and Vietnam. Our online and in-person short courses are designed to prepare students for their future with a variety of programmes that cater to skills needed in the years to come, whether that be learning how to code in our Robotics Programme, how to be business-ready in our Business Management Programme or how to become a fantastic speaker in our Public Speaking & Leadership programme. There is something for everyone at BlueSky Education and we want students to come away with better English skills and life skills which they can take with them through life far after camp has ended.

OUR STUDY TOUR OFFERINGS 

We work with the biggest study travel agencies, English tutoring centres, and public and private schools in Vietnam and Japan. Our current Australia offerings include one-day to 3 week long campus or homestay programmes in Public Speaking, Sustainable Future, Business & Startup, local school immersion, campus Brothers & Sisters programmes and guest speakers sessions.

KEY RESPONSIBILITIES & DUTIES

As our STUDY TOURS are bouncing back strongly post COVID, we are looking for a full-time Australia-Based Study Tour Academic Manager to manage and professionalise our camp academic content and ensure the highest customer satisfaction. This will be one of the most crucial roles in our company as programme delivery quality decides if our clients will return for more business with us in the following year.

Working with an international team based in Singapore, Vietnam and the Philippines, you are responsible for improving existing and creating new programme curricula for Australia. Specifically, you will be responsible for the following areas:
 

1)  Study Tours Planning

  • Revise and improve upon the existing set of camp curriculum and develop curriculum for new programmes  
  • Create programme schedules based on client requests 
  • Advertise, shortlist, interview and recruit freelancer teachers and guest speakers for online and in-person Youth and Adult programmes ensuring selected teachers have the personality and qualification to deliver our programmes in a fun and gamified study tour style. 
  • Coordinate programme curriculum preparation including briefing and training freelancer teachers and contractors.
  • Attend conferences and local associations, and stay updated on Study Tour industry trends and themes. Incorporate trending themes in programme curriculum design to attract client interest. 
  • Represent Blue Sky Education as Academic Manager in client meetings and events.
  • Lead effort in identifying new technological tools to enhance and improve our programme delivery. 

2) Study Tours Execution

  • Onboard freelancer teachers ensuring teachers are briefed on curriculum, teaching methodology and expectation
  • Observe teachers and conduct quality control of our camp class teaching, manage freelancer teachers and be the point of contact to solve any problem and customer complaint related to programme curriculum and teaching that might arise during camps
  • Teach and deliver existing Blue Sky short-term Education Programmes as and when required
  • Work with camp managers to ensure our clients (school directors, teachers, chaperons) feel they are listened to and cared for. 

3) Marketing

  • Contribute to team effort in producing marketing materials (websites, brochures, videos, marketing campaigns, brochures)
  • Coordinate with the marketing team to execute marketing campaigns.

This role is exciting as you will be working with several external stakeholders (local partners, overseas clients, students). You will be the face of our camps when students from overseas arrive in Australia. The role also comes with the challenges of planning and executing curriculum delivery in multiple camps in various cities across Australia while being based in Sydney. 

REQUIREMENT

This role best suits candidates with 4-7 years of work experience in ESL teaching who appreciate a dynamic role, not a typical 9 am to 5 pm role. You will not be sitting in an office all day and doing the same thing. You will be on campus with our students and clients when programmes are running (Feb-March, June-August), and return to your office during the low season. 

To excel in this role, you will need to be well-organised and excel at creating a fun curriculum for young learners. 

This role best suits candidates with ESL teaching qualifications (TELSO, CELTA) and experience teaching non-native speaker students from Asia (Japan, Vietnam, Korea, Thailand). We are looking for candidates with a warm and energetic personality and the ability to connect with students and build relationships with clients. 
 

  • Full working rights in Australia with strong local knowledge 
  • Bachelor degree holder 
  • Teaching experience for young learners who are non-native speakers 
  • A warm personality, with a willingness and capacity to extend themselves and embrace new challenges such as leading group activities and conducting team building activities
  • Ability to build rapport with students and clients
  • Enjoy working with teenagers and young students 
  • Computer literate and proven competence in administration
  • Flexible, adaptable and solutions-focused
  • Effective communicator with a well-projected voice
  • Experience in designing curriculum and programme content/themes for study groups 
  • ESL teaching qualifications (TELSO, CELTA) are a must. 
  • Working with children check 

REMUNERATION/BENEFITS 

  • Annual salary package of AUD 65,000 - AUD 85,000 per annum + super. 
  • Work in a dynamic and fun Coworking space within the Wework office with free daily tea/coffee and monthly community events 
  • Opportunity to travel domestically to Melbourne, Brisbane, Perth and Adelaide where our programmes are delivered 
  • Opportunity for international travel to Japan, Singapore and Vietnam to support Global Team. 
  • A flexible working arrangement with a combination of working from home and in the office.
